Sinopsis

A classic collection of imaginative animal tales in which Rudyard Kipling invents playful origins for the camel’s hump, the elephant’s trunk, the leopard’s spots, and other memorable wonders. Written in a voice that is at once mischievous, musical, and unmistakably his own, these stories remain among the most enduring works in children’s literature, combining fanciful explanation with verbal charm and a strong read-aloud quality.First published in the early twentieth century, Just So Stories stands at the meeting point of folklore, bedtime storytelling, and literary classic. Kipling’s narratives are rich with repetition, rhythm, and comic invention, making them especially effective for family reading while also preserving their place as a landmark of English juvenile fiction. This edition offers the complete tales in a clear, accessible format for modern readers.

Acerca del autor

Rudyard Kipling was an English author, poet, and storyteller whose works include The Jungle Book, Kim, and Just So Stories. He was one of the most widely read writers of the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ries and remains especially noted for his children's literature, narrative verse, and stories shaped by oral cadence and memorable phrasing.
